使用 GroupDocs.Conversion for .NET 將 MPT 轉換為 TEX:無縫檔案轉換指南

介紹

您是否希望在 .NET 應用程式中將 Microsoft Project 檔案 (MPT) 無縫轉換為 LaTeX (TEX) 格式?本教學將指導您使用 GroupDocs.Conversion for .NET,這是一個功能強大的程式庫,可簡化檔案轉換。完成本指南後,您將能夠輕鬆地將此功能整合到您的軟體解決方案中。

您將學到什麼:

  • 如何為 .NET 設定 GroupDocs.Conversion。
  • 將 MPT 檔案轉換為 TEX 格式的步驟。
  • 優化效能和解決常見問題的提示。

讓我們深入了解開始此轉換過程所需的先決條件。

先決條件

在開始之前,請確保您已具備以下條件:

所需的庫和依賴項

  • GroupDocs.轉換 庫(版本 25.3.0 或更高版本)。

環境設定要求

  • .NET 開發環境(例如 Visual Studio)。
  • 對 C# 程式設計有基本的了解。

為 .NET 設定 GroupDocs.Conversion

要使用 GroupDocs.Conversion,您需要安裝該軟體包並正確設定您的環境。操作方法如下:

NuGet 套件管理器控制台

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

許可證取得步驟

  1. 免費試用: 您可以先從下載免費試用版開始 群組文檔.
  2. 臨時執照: 申請臨時許可證以探索全部功能 群組文檔.
  3. 購買: 如需繼續使用,請透過 GroupDocs 購買頁面.

基本初始化和設定

以下是如何在 C# 專案中初始化 GroupDocs.Conversion:

using System;
using GroupDocs.Conversion;

實施指南

本節將引導您使用 GroupDocs.Conversion for .NET 實作 MPT 到 TEX 的轉換。

將 MPT 轉換為 TEX 特徵

概述

將 MPT 檔案轉換為 TEX 格式對於將專案資料整合到 LaTeX 文件至關重要。以下是使用 GroupDocs.Conversion 簡單實作此操作的方法。

逐步實施

1. 載入來源MPT文件

首先載入原始檔。使用 Converter 班級:

string inputFilePath = "YOUR_DOCUMENT_DIRECTORY\\sample.mpt";
using (var converter = new Converter(inputFilePath))
{
    // 轉換邏輯在這裡
}

2. 配置TEX格式的轉換選項

接下來,配置轉換選項以指定我們想要 TEX 輸出:

PageDescriptionLanguageConvertOptions options = 
    new PageDescriptionLanguageConvertOptions {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ex };

解釋: 這裡, PageDescriptionLanguageConvertOptions 設定為將檔案轉換為 LaTeX 格式。

3.執行轉換

最後,執行轉換並儲存輸出:

string outputFolder = @"YOUR_OUTPUT_DIRECTORY\";
string outputFile = Path.Combine(outputFolder, "mpt-converted-to.tex");

converter.Convert(outputFile, options);

解釋:Convert 方法採用輸出檔的路徑和配置的選項來執行轉換。

故障排除提示

  • 確保程式碼中的路徑正確。
  • 驗證您是否具有讀取/寫入檔案的適當權限。

實際應用

將 MPT 檔案轉換為 TEX 在以下幾種情況下很有用:

  1. 學術研究: 將專案時間表整合到 LaTeX 報告中。
  2. 技術文件: 在技術文件中包括項目計劃。
  3. 數據分析: 使用 LaTeX 以視覺化方式呈現項目資料。

這些用例示範如何將此功能與其他 .NET 系統和框架集成,從而增強應用程式的功能。

性能考慮

為確保使用 GroupDocs.Conversion 時效能穩定:

  • 優化資源使用: 監控記憶體使用情況以防止瓶頸。
  • 遵循最佳實務: 正確處置物體以有效管理資源。

這些技巧將有助於在處理文件轉換時保持 .NET 應用程式的最佳效能。

結論

現在,您已經學習如何使用 GroupDocs.Conversion for .NET 將 MPT 檔案轉換為 TEX 檔案。此功能對您的軟體專案來說非常實用,尤其是在將專案資料整合到 LaTeX 文件時。接下來,您可以考慮探索 GroupDocs.Conversion 支援的其他轉換格式,以進一步增強您的應用程式功能。

準備好在你的專案中實現它了嗎?開始嘗試,看看它如何融入你的解決方案!

常見問題部分

Q1:使用 GroupDocs.Conversion for .NET 將 MPT 轉換為 TEX 的主要用途是什麼? A1:這種轉換有助於將專案資料整合到 LaTeX 文件中,這對於報告和文件很有用。

問題 2:我可以使用 GroupDocs.Conversion 轉換其他文件格式嗎? A2:是的,GroupDocs.Conversion 支援 MPT 和 TEX 以外的多種檔案格式。

Q3:如何處理轉換過程中的錯誤? A3:在程式碼中實作錯誤處理以捕獲異常並記錄錯誤以便進行故障排除。

問題 4:使用 GroupDocs.Conversion 是否需要付費? A4:雖然可以免費試用,但長期使用可能需要購買許可證。

Q5:在哪裡可以找到更多有關使用 GroupDocs.Conversion 的資源? A5:訪問 GroupDocs 文檔 以獲得全面的指南和 API 參考。

資源